Introduction: Navigating the Competitive Landscape of Microelectronic Medical Implants
The microelectronic medical implant market is experiencing unprecedented competitive pressures, driven by rapid technological development, changing regulatory frameworks and increased demand for individualized care. The market’s key players, including original equipment manufacturers, IT systems integrators and the most advanced artificial intelligence start-ups, are competing to offer the most advanced services, based on artificial intelligence-based analytics, Internet of Things connectivity and biometric monitoring systems. These technology-based product differentiators are not only enhancing the performance of the devices, but are also reshaping the market and the competitive landscape. Strategic deployment is increasingly orientated towards the integration of automation and green systems, in order to meet the demands of regulation and the preferences of consumers. This interplay of factors is reshaping the market and the strategic landscape, and C-level managers and strategic planners must stay ahead of the curve.

Emerging Players & Regional Champions
- NeuroTech Innovations, Inc. (USA): Specializes in the development of advanced neurostimulators for the treatment of chronic pain, recently signed a contract with a major health insurance company for a pilot project, competes with established vendors by offering more flexible solutions.
- BioImplant Solutions (Germany) specializes in biodegradable microelectronics for cardiac applications. They have recently completed a successful trial in cooperation with a leading university hospital. They complement existing suppliers with more eco-friendly products.
- MedTech Dynamics (India): MedTech Dynamics has developed a low-cost implantable microelectronics for diabetes, and has entered into cooperative agreements with the local governments to increase access to health care. MedTech Dynamics is also a challenger to established players, because it is focusing on the price-sensitive markets.
- SMART BIO DEVICES (Israel): The company develops smart implantable devices with an integrated AI for real-time health monitoring. The company recently launched a product in Europe, thereby complementing the offerings of established suppliers with enhanced data analysis capabilities.
